Matthew Bonner vs Darren Stewart report

Who won Bonner vs Stewart?

Darren Stewart beat Matthew Bonner by unanimous decision in their 3 round contest during the main event of Cage Warriors 156, on Saturday 1st July 2023 at Vale Sports Arena in Cardiff.

The scorecards were announced in favor of the winner Darren Stewart.

The fight was scheduled to take place over 3 rounds in the Middleweight division, which meant the weight limit was 185 pounds (13.2 stone or 83.9 KG).

Bonner vs Stewart stats

Matthew Bonner stepped into the octagon with a record of 14 wins, 8 losses and 1 draw, 5 of those wins coming by the way of knock out and 5 by submission.

Darren Stewart made his way to the cage with a record of 14 wins, 9 losses and 0 draws, 8 of those wins coming by knock out and 1 by submission.

Matthew Bonner's Cage Warriors record stood at 12-7-1, while Darren Stewart's came in at 8-3-0.

The stats suggested Stewart had a large advantage in power over Bonner, boasting a 57% knock out percentage over Bonner's 36%.

If the fight went to the ground, their records suggested Bonner had a large advantage over Stewart, boasting a 36% submission rate over Stewart's 7%.

Matthew Bonner was the same age as Darren Stewart, at 33 years old.

Bonner had a height advantage of 2 inches over Stewart.

Bonner's experience as a professional fighter was relatively equal to Stewart's, having had the same amount of fights, and made his debut in 2017, 2 years and 11 months later than Stewart, whose first professional fight was in 2014. He had fought 9 more professional rounds, 67 to Stewart's 58.

Bonner vs Stewart form

Darren Stewart had beaten 1 of his last 5 opponents.

In his last fight before this contest, he had lost to Dustin Jacoby at UFC Vegas 35 on 28th August 2021 by knockout in the 1st round at UFC APEX, Enterprise, United States.

Previous to that, he had been beaten by Eryk Anders at UFC 263 on 12th June 2021 by unanimous decision in their 3 round contest at Gila River Arena, Glendale.

Going into that contest, his fight against Eryk Anders at UFC Vegas 21 on 13th March 2021 ended in a no contest.

Before that, he had been defeated by Kevin Holland at UFC Vegas 11 on 19th September 2020 by split decision in their 3 round contest at UFC APEX, Las Vegas.

He had won against Maki Pitolo at UFC Vegas 6 on 8th August 2020 by submission in the 1st round at UFC APEX, Las Vegas.
